Reports to: Chief Financial Officer

Position Overview:

The VP, Financial Controller will be responsible for all Financial Reporting and Accounting functions for the organization including providing consolidated monthly, quarterly, and annual financial reporting packages to the CFO. The Controller is also responsible for overall GAAP compliance and the external reporting package to the board of directors. The VP, Controller works jointly with the VP, Finance to complete expert financial planning and analysis including analyzing current and past trends in key performance indicators including all areas of revenue, cost of sales, expenses and capital expenditures; regulatory reporting, business intelligence and managing the budget process for a multi-unit, multi-state Company. This is a hybrid role with a work location in Chelmsford, MA.

Major Areas of Responsibility:
  • Oversee the overall accounting and tax functions of the company including internal and external reporting, month-end close, consolidated reporting package and assisting in budgeting, forecasting and other finance related tasks.
  • Continue to drive our public-company readiness initiative, including, but not limited to, fully compliant PCAOB financials and audit as well as SOX readiness.
  • Preparation of quarterly earnings release schedules.
  • Monitor performance indicators, highlighting trends and analyzing causes of unexpected variance.
  • Routinely communicate business unit and company consolidated financial and operational performance trends, historical and forecasted, using appropriate metrics. Suggest trends, resulting implications, key actions, and strategic implications.
  • Provide expert guidance to a large accounting group.
  • Ad-Hoc Reporting and Analysis.
  • Quarterly and Monthly Financial reports.
  • Develop financial models and analyses to support strategic initiatives.
  • Analyze complex financial information and reports to provide accurate and timely financial recommendations to management for decision making purposes
    Prepare presentation to Board of Directors and Senior Management Team.

About The Cannabist Company:

The Cannabist Company, formerly known as Columbia Care, is one of the most experienced cultivators, manufacturers and providers of cannabis products and related services, with licenses in 14 U.S. jurisdictions. The Company operates 75 facilities including 56 dispensaries and 19 cultivation and manufacturing facilities, including those under development. Columbia Care, now The Cannabist Company, is one of the original multi-state providers of cannabis in the U.S. and now delivers industry-leading products and services to both the medical and adult-use markets. In 2021, the Company launched Cannabist, its retail brand, creating a national dispensary network that leverages proprietary technology platforms. The company offers products spanning flower, edibles, oils and tablets, and manufactures popular brands including dreamt, Seed & Strain, Triple Seven, Hedy, gLeaf, Classix, Press, and Amber.
